The School of Teacher Education and Leadership (TEAL) administers a program leading to a doctoral degree (PhD) in Education specializing in Curriculum and Instruction. This degree is designed to prepare educators who wish to become:

  • curriculum specialists,
  • coordinators and supervisors in public or private school systems,
  • leaders in state departments of public instruction,
  • instructors at the college or university level in K-12 teacher or administrator preparation,
  • educational researchers serving in various contexts.

PhD in Education Concentration Areas

All PhD in Education students must complete the required Curriculum & Instruction Specialization Core and Research Core coursework. Additionally, the PhD in Education Program offers coursework across disciplinary areas to fulfill requirements for an area of concentration. Students may select any of the five concentrations:


Cultural Studies in Education


School Leadership

Literacy Education and Leadership

Mathematics Education and Leadership

Science Education

The School of Teacher Education and Leadership (TEAL) provides Course Planning Guides to help students plan which courses to take to complete their approved Programs of Study. These Planning Guides are available on the concentration webpages and in the TEAL Doctoral Student Handbook.
